When shopping for auto insurance for students in college, one of the many considerations used to determine the price you pay for insurance is where you keep your car in Tennessee. More populated areas like Memphis, Germantown, and Jackson are more likely to pay higher prices, whereas areas with less people or fewer weather incidents enjoy lower auto insurance rates.

Who has the cheapest insurance quotes for students in college?

You have many ways to compare cheaper car insurance rates in Tennessee, but the most common methods are from a non-exclusive or independent agent, an exlusive agent such as Allstate or Auto-Owners, or from a direct company like Progressive or Geico.

All three ways can provide car insurance quotes, but they are slightly different in how they function.

Independent insurance agents are appointed by several companies and can get policy pricing from each one. These types of agents can sell policies from many different companies and can provide you with more rates, which may give you better odds of saving money. If cheaper coverage is found, the agent simply finds a different carrier which is easy for the insured.

An exlusive, or captive, agency is only able to write with a single insurance company, a couple examples are an Allstate or State Farm agent. This type of agents cannot compare rates from other companies, so if finding the cheapest coverage is your goal, you will need to shop around.

Buying car insurance direct means you forego an independent or exclusive agent and instead buy from a direct company like Geico. Shopping for car insurance direct is a good choice for families who do not have a complex risk profile and have a decent understanding of what specific coverages and deductibles they need.

So which way is best to buy the cheapest car insurance for college students in Tennessee? It would be easy to say buying from a direct company results in the cheapest rates since that eliminates agent commissions, but that generally is not the case. It would also be easy to say an independent agent results in the cheapest rates due to increased selection, but again, that’s not accurate. In the right set of circumstances, the exclusive agents have coverage prices that are the cheapest.

Because there is so much variation in car insurance prices, the best method to make sure you’re not overpaying for car insurance is to obtain price quotes and compare them.
